Overview
As a Student Advisor (Enrichment), you will be at the forefront of guiding students towards holistic growth and development. Your role goes beyond academic counselling; you will empower students to explore diverse opportunities for personal and professional enrichment, ensuring they thrive both inside and outside the classroom.
Proactively build positive relationships and rapport with students in the Student Support Centre and communal areas, modelling appropriate behaviours via informal and formal interactions. Provide friendly, accurate, and up-to-date advice, guidance, support, and signposting to learners in the Open Plan Student Support Centre from a 1:1 Support Desk on a rotational basis.
Assist learners in completing internal application forms for financial funds such as the 16-19 Bursary, 19+ Learner Support Fund, West London Trust Fund, and 24+ Bursary Fund. Provide break/lunchtime enrichment activities on a rotational basis in the designated communal areas, engaging with students to ensure that their leisure time is spent constructively and helping them maintain appropriate standards of behaviour.
Establish and maintain clear boundaries and expectations around attendance and punctuality, effectively challenge behaviour and regularly signpost students to support services, enrichment activities/events and employability opportunities. Take appropriate and timely action to safeguard students, providing consistent and professional service to all students. Identify and report any Safeguarding concerns using the College's internal and external procedures.

What we offer
We value our team and offer a wide range of benefits to recognise the hard work they put into supporting our learners. As a member of the support team, you will receive the following:
* Excellent Holiday Allowance, plus bank holidays (8) and college closure days at Christmas (3)
* Eye care vouchers
* Cycle to Work scheme
* Interest-free loans for Season tickets; Computers
* Contributory average salary with Local Government Pension Scheme (LGPS)
* Continuous Professional Development Events (CPD)
* Access to Perkbox, our rewards and discount platform
* Access to the Colleges Employee Assistance Programme (EAP)
* Discount at the College's on-site hair and beauty salon
